I would use a 50-way female connectors on the baseplate - like the ones used on SCSI drives. They're common and cheap. You can prototype on vero and use 90 degree plugs on your cards. Good lighting is also necessary when taking PCB pix. The one here http://arduinonut.blogspot.com was taken by sticking the PCB to a cupboard door :) Other times I use a worklamp pointed onto the board so the shadows from the camera doesn't interfere.
